About the Role
We are looking for reliable and experienced Class 2 Drivers to join our team in Manchester on a temp-to-perm basis. This role is ideal for drivers who enjoy consistent work. You will typically complete 15-20 deliveries of kegs to pubs and bars whilst collecting the empty ones back around Manchester. This involves lots of manual handling and heavy work. You will have to ensure all goods are delivered safely, efficiently, and on time.
Requirements
- Valid Class 2 (Category C) licence
- Valid CPC and Digital Tachograph Card
- Minimum 6 months Class 2 experience
- 18+ years old
- No more than 6 penalty points (no major endorsements such as DR, IN, or TT)
- Good understanding of drivers' hours and working time regulations
- Reliable, professional, and safety-conscious

Pay Rates:
Your hourly pay rate is £16 and you will accrue £1.93 per hour in holiday pay for every hour worked, which is banked and paid to you when you take annual leave. We do this to make sure our drivers are fairly paid and encouraged to take proper time off work as we believe regular rest is essential for safety and mental wellbeing of all workers.
